Answer:
6 C O 2 + 6 H 2 O + Δ → C 6 H 12 O 6 + 6 O 2
Explanation:
The Δ symbol denotes added energy, here in the form of sunlight. Strong C = O , and O − H bonds have been broken, and this bond cleavage is only partially energetically compensated by the formation of C − H and O = O bonds. Hence the reaction is endothermic (energy input on LHS). Note that the reaction is balanced with respect to mass and charge (says he, checking to see whether it is indeed balanced!).
Formula: molality, m = n solute / kg solvent
n solute = # of moles of solute = mass(g) / molar mass
Molar mass of Mg Br2 = 184.11 g/mol
m = [46g / 184.11 g/mol] / 0.5 kg = 0.50 mol/kg
